<p style='text-align: justify;'>Recto: part of the draft of an Aramaic contract, dated before 1213 CE, in which Sitt [...] (space left for her name) sells her maidservant (name unknown at the time of writing so given as ‘Pelonit’), to Elʿazar ha-Kohen. The price is not preserved, but what remains is still very detailed. Verso and foot of recto: text in Judaeo-Arabic with draft accounts of the pious foundations (i.e. Heqdeš), dated to 1213 CE. </p>
